- [ ] Step 7: Archive cold storage buckets (Glacierline tier). Confirm both ceremony witnesses are present, verify bucket manifests match the Oxbow ledger, then seal the archive key shares. Plugin authors may observe but not handle shares. Once sealed, the archive index itself is encrypted and can only be reopened with the passphrase below.

vault phrase of badup-hahig = tamael-aldael-kelmir-istael-fenok-istwyn-tamius-jorath-oliion

## Authentication

Matchbox (the pairing service) exposes GC pause metrics at `/internal/gc`. Pauses over 400ms page on-call. The endpoint is behind the Kestrelgate proxy; anonymous calls return 403. Auth is a static service key in the `X-Matchbox-Key` header — no OAuth, no refresh. Keys rotate quarterly; stale keys fail closed, which looks identical to a network partition, so check auth first. The current on-call key for the GC metrics endpoint is below.

API key for kahap-faduf: vxb23-Ir087IkWYmBJt7KRtkyhUA3

/*
 * RestockPilot client setup — for external plugin authors.
 * This client talks to the Corridor restock-planning API: it pulls
 * machine inventory snapshots, predicts sell-through, and returns a
 * suggested restock route. Plugins must call init() before any
 * planner methods. Rate limit: 60 req/min per plugin. Sandbox data
 * only; production machines are off-limits. Initialize the client
 * with the key below.
 */

API key for bahop-yajog: qvz3-mhf